如何搭建SqlServer集群
时间: 2024-06-01 08:10:51 浏览: 16
要搭建SqlServer集群,需要遵循以下步骤:
1.选择合适的硬件和网络设备:SqlServer集群需要至少两台服务器,每台服务器都应该有足够的CPU、内存和磁盘空间。此外,还需要一个高速网络设备,如交换机或路由器,确保服务器之间的通信速度和稳定性。
2.安装SqlServer软件:在每台服务器上安装SqlServer软件。在安装过程中,需要选择“安装成集群”选项,并指定共享存储设备的位置。
3.配置共享存储设备:共享存储设备是SqlServer集群中的核心组件。它应该是高可用性的,并且需要为所有服务器提供访问权限。在共享存储设备上创建一个磁盘阵列,并将其分配给所有SqlServer服务器。
4.创建SqlServer群集:使用Windows群集管理工具创建SqlServer群集。在创建过程中,需要指定群集名称、IP地址和共享存储设备的位置。
5.配置SqlServer群集:在SqlServer群集管理工具中配置SqlServer群集。这包括配置群集节点、网络名称、虚拟服务器实例等。
6.测试SqlServer集群:测试SqlServer集群以确保其正常运行。测试应包括故障转移测试,以确保在某个节点出现故障时,SqlServer群集可以自动切换到另一个节点。
以上是搭建SqlServer集群的基本步骤。需要注意的是,搭建SqlServer集群需要一定的专业知识和技能,建议在实施之前请咨询专业人士。
相关问题
linux sqlserver集群搭建
在 Linux 上搭建 SQL Server 集群需要使用 MySQL 群集技术。MySQL 5.0 及以上的二进制版本以及与最新的 Linux 版本兼容的 RPM 包中提供了该存储引擎。MySQL 群集技术允许在无共享的系统中部署“内存中”和“磁盘中”数据库的 Cluster。
要搭建 Linux SQL Server 集群,您需要执行以下步骤:
1. 安装 MySQL 5.0 及以上版本,并确保安装了与最新的 Linux 版本兼容的 RPM 包。
2. 配置 MySQL 群集。您可以按照官方文档或相关教程进行操作。
3. 使用 mssql-conf 工具进行 SQL Server 的设置和配置。例如,在终端上执行以下命令:`/opt/mssql/bin/mssql-conf setup`
4. 为 Pacemaker 创建 SQL Server 登录账号,并授予可用组 LINUX_SQLAG 权限。
5. 设置集群的网络通信,确保所有节点能够相互通信。
6. 在所有节点上安装相同版本的 SQL Server,并确保所有节点上的 SQL Server 配置文件相同。
7. 配置 Pacemaker 集群资源,包括 SQL Server 服务和相关的资源,例如 IP 地址、磁盘资源等。
8. 启动 Pacemaker 集群,并验证 SQL Server 服务是否正常运行。
sqlserver集群搭建
SQL Server 集群搭建需要考虑多个方面,下面是一个大致的步骤:
1. 确认硬件和网络环境是否满足要求,如磁盘空间、内存、CPU、网络带宽等。
2. 安装 Windows Server 操作系统,并进行必要的配置,如域名、IP 地址、网络共享等。
3. 安装 SQL Server,并进行必要的配置,如数据库文件的位置、备份策略、安全性等。
4. 配置 SQL Server 实例的故障转移群集,如创建群集、添加节点、指定群集 IP 等。
5. 配置 SQL Server 实例的 AlwaysOn 可用性组,如创建可用性组、添加副本、指定读取访问策略等。
6. 测试故障转移和自动故障转移功能,确保在主节点故障时,能够自动切换到备用节点。
需要注意的是,SQL Server 集群搭建需要具备一定的技术水平和经验,操作不当可能会导致数据丢失或系统崩溃。建议在实际操作前,先进行全面的测试和备份,确保数据的安全性。